06 Sep 2018

In focusing his attention on the competitors of Mr Gay Syria, director Ayse Toprak shatters the one-dimensional meaning of “refugee”. Using the pageant as a means of escape from political persecution, the organiser Mahmoud — already given asylum in Berlin — hopes to offer the winner a chance to travel as well as bring international attention to the life-threatening situations faced by LGBT Syrians.

01 Jan 1983

A documentary incorporating footage of Montgomery Clift’s most memorable films; interviews with family and friends, and rare archival material stretching back to his childhood. What develops is the story of an intense young boy who yearned for stardom, achieved notable success in such classic films as From Here to Eternity and I Confess, only to be ruined by alcohol addiction and his inability to face his own fears and homosexual desires. Montgomery Clift, as this film portrays him, may not have been a happy man but he never compromised his acting talents for Hollywood.

01 Jan 1988

Richard Fontaine and Bob Mizer started the current exploration of the male nude in film and photography. The two shared ideas props and models and reinvented some of the sexual icons that we all still recognise today. The gladiator the sailor, the cowboy… Starting with posing-straps and graduating to nudes their "art studies" enlisted the talents of up-and-coming actors and bodybuilders. This film recalls that era.
